Which of the following statements is NOT true regarding theories of aging?
 a. Free radical damage is known to promote chronic conditions including heart disease, cataracts, and some cancers.
  b. Scientists postulate that if they could shorten the telomeres of chromosomes more slowly than happens naturally, cell senescence could be delayed.
  c. Protein cross-links form because of exposure to high glucose levels, resulting in adverse changes in tissue and organ function.
  d. Cells from long-lived species (such as humans) have higher Hayflick limits than cells from shorter-lived species (such as mice or rats).

Mrs. Brown is 55 years old and 5 ft. 3 in. tall, with a medium frame. She reports having lost 20 pounds in the last 6 months and now weighs 130 pounds. She eats 2 meals a day and is complaining that food has lost its taste, and when she eats, she feels something sticking in her throat, pain, and discomfort; she has ill-fitting dentures that she does not wear very often. What would be an appropriate amount of protein to recommend to Mrs. Brown if she is eating 1,000 Calories per day?
 a. 55 grams/day
  b. 77 grams/day
  c. 95 grams/day
  d. 100 grams/day
  e. >100 grams/day
